Administrators from Baker Tilly Restructuring and Recovery have been appointed to a group of companies which, between them, operate over 100 Adult Gaming Centres, most of which trade under the ‘Agora’ or ‘Caesar’s World’ brand.
The four companies involved are Ablethird Ltd, Frankice (Golders Green) Ltd, Leisure World (UK) Ltd and Caesar’s World Ltd. The latter three companies control the gaming centres, which employ in the region of 500 people.
Commenting on the appointment, Baker Tilly Partner, David Hudson, said: “We have been appointed with a view to marketing and restructuring the business after a short trading period.
“This is a very well established network of businesses with a considerable number of well-located outlets. We hope to achieve a sale of the business as a going concern and would like to hear from interested parties.”
